Sadržaj
Ako želite izdvojiti jedinstvene stavke s popisa u programu Excel , ovaj će vam članak biti od velike pomoći. Ovdje ćemo vas provesti kroz 10 jednostavnih metoda izdvajanja jedinstvenih stavki s popisa.
Preuzmi radnu knjigu
Izdvoj jedinstvenih stavki.xlsm
10 metoda za izdvajanje jedinstvenih stavki s popisa u Excelu
Ovdje opisujemo svaku od metoda korak po korak kako biste mogli izdvojiti jedinstvene stavke s popisa bez napora. Koristili smo Excel 365. Možete koristiti bilo koju dostupnu verziju programa Excel.
Metoda-1: Izdvojite jedinstvene stavke s popisa pomoću formule polja
Sljedeći Popis proizvoda sadrži ID broj i Naziv proizvoda . Vidimo da postoji ponavljanje u Nazivu proizvoda . Želimo izdvojiti jedinstvene proizvode s tog popisa. Koristit ćemo Array Formulu za izdvajanje jedinstvenih stavki.
➤ Za početak ćemo napisati sljedeću formulu u ćeliju E5 .
=IFERROR(INDEX($C$5:$C$12,MATCH(0,COUNTIF($E$4:E4,$C$5:$C$12),0)),"")
Ova formula je kombinacija I NDE X , MATC H i COUNTIF funkcije.
- COUNTIF($E$4 :E4,$C$5:$C$12) → Provjerava jedinstveni popis i vraća 0 kada se podudaranje ne pronađe i 1 kada se podudaranje pronađe.
- MATCH(0,COUNTIF($E$4:E4,$C$5:$C$12),0) → Identificira poziciju prvog pojavljivanja ne podudaranja, ovdje ga programirajte predstavljati sa0.
- INDEX($C$5:$C$12,MATCH(0,COUNTIF($E$4:E4,$C$5:$C$12),0)) → INDEX koristi poziciju koju vraća MATCH i vraća naziv stavke s popisa.
- Možete naići na pogreške kada ih više nema unikatni predmeti. Da bismo ga se riješili, upotrijebili smo funkciju IFERROR , pomoću funkcije zamijenili smo poruku o pogrešci praznom.
➤ Nakon toga moramo pritisnuti Enter .
➤ Moramo povući prema dolje formulu pomoću Fill Handle alata .
➤ Konačno, možemo vidjeti jedinstvene stavke u tablici Jedinstveni proizvodi koji koriste formulu niza .
Pročitajte više: VBA za dobivanje jedinstvenih vrijednosti iz stupca u polje u Excelu (3 kriterija)
Metoda-2: Upotreba UNIQUE funkcije za izdvajanje s popisa
Želimo izdvojiti jedinstvene stavke iz sljedećeg Naziva proizvoda pomoću UNIQUE funkcije .
➤ Prije svega, upisat ćemo =UNIQUE u ćeliju E5 i pojavit će se UNIQUE funkcija .
➤ Moramo odabrati niz , koji je naš Naziv proizvoda , stoga odabiremo C5 do C12 .
➤ Nakon toga, moramo staviti zarez, ” , ”, i moramo dvaput kliknuti na False-Return unique rows .
➤ Zatvorit ćemo zagradu i pritisnuti Enter .
➤ Konačno, možemo vidjeti izdvajanje jedinstvenih stavki utablicu Popis jedinstvenih proizvoda pomoću funkcije UNIQUE . Također možemo vidjeti formulu na traci formula .
Pročitajte više: Pronađite jedinstvene vrijednosti u stupcu u Excelu (6 metoda)
Metoda-3: Korištenje formule bez polja funkcija LOOKUP i COUNTIF
Možemo koristiti formulu bez polja koja se sastoji od LOOKUP i COUNTIF također. Pogledajmo kako nam ova formula pomaže da izdvojimo jedinstveno s popisa.
Ovdje upisujemo sljedeću formulu u ćeliju E5 .
=LOOKUP(2,1/(COUNTIF($E$4:E4,$C$5:$C$12)=0),$C$5:$C$12)
- COUNTIF($E$4:E4,$C$5:$C$12) → Provjerava jedinstveni popis i vraća 0 kada se podudaranje ne pronađe i 1 ako se podudaranje pronađe. Ovo generira polje koje se sastoji od binarnih vrijednosti TRUE i FALSE . Zatim podijelite 1 s ovim poljem koje daje drugo polje vrijednosti 1 i #DIV/0 pogreške.
- Vanjska funkcija LOOKUP ima 2 kao traženje vrijednost, gdje rezultat COUNTIF dijela radi kao lookup_vector. Uspoređujući ovo dvoje, LOOKUP usklađuje konačnu vrijednost pogreške i vraća odgovarajuću vrijednost.
➤ Zatim ćemo pritisnuti Unesite .
➤ Povući ćemo prema dolje formulu pomoću Ručke za popunjavanje .
➤ Konačno, možemo vidjeti izdvojene jedinstvene stavke u Jedinstveni proizvod korištenjem Non Array Formule tablice. Također možemo vidjeti formulu u formulitraka .
Pročitajte više: Kako izdvojiti jedinstvene vrijednosti na temelju kriterija u programu Excel
Metoda-4: Ekstrahiraj izuzimajući duplikate pomoću formule niza
U ovoj metodi ćemo izdvojiti jedinstvene stavke isključujući duplikate pomoću niza formule.
➤ Prvo ćemo upisat će sljedeću formulu u ćeliju E5 .
=INDEX(List,MATCH(0,INDEX(COUNTIF(E4:$E$4,List)+(COUNTIF(List,List)1),0,0),0))
Ovdje, E4:$E$4 je prva ćelija stupca za koji želimo izbaciti rezultat izdvajanja, a Popis je raspon odabranih ćelija od C5 do C12 .
Dvije INDEX funkcije vraćaju početnu i konačnu vrijednost iz lokacije koja je izvedena pomoću COUNTIFS odnosno MATCH .
➤ Nakon toga ćemo pritisnuti Enter .
➤ Zatim ćemo povući formulu prema dolje pomoću alata Fill Handle .
➤ Konačno, možemo vidjeti dva jedinstvena proizvoda isključujući dupliciranje.
Pročitajte više: Kako dobiti jedinstvene vrijednosti iz raspona u Excelu (8 metoda)
Metoda-5: Izdvojite jedinstvene stavke s popisa pomoću naprednog filtra
Možete koristiti Excel značajku pod nazivom Napredni filtar za izdvajanje jedinstvenih stavki s popisa. Hajdemo saznati kako to učiniti.
➤ Prvo odaberite raspon podataka koje želite izdvojiti
➤ Nakon toga kliknite karticu Podaci .
Ovdje smo odabrali ćelije i istražili Podatke kartica. Tamo ćete pronaći opciju Napredno (unutar grupe naredbi Sortiraj i filtriraj ).
➤ Nakon toga, pojavit će se prozor Napredni filtar .
➤ Odabrat ćemo Kopiraj na drugu lokaciju
➤ Dat ćemo lokaciju $E $4 u okviru Kopiraj u
➤ Provjerite jeste li kliknuli na Samo jedinstveni zapisi .
➤ Sada kliknite na OK .
➤ Konačno, možemo vidjeti da su jedinstvene stavke izdvojene u tablici Jedinstveni proizvod pomoću Napredni filtar .
Pročitajte više: Kako pronaći jedinstvene vrijednosti iz više stupaca u programu Excel
Metoda-6: Izdvoj jedinstvenih vrijednosti koje razlikuju velika i mala slova
Ako imamo različite vrijednosti koje razlikuju velika i mala slova kao u sljedećoj tablici List , možemo koristiti Niz formulu za izdvajanje jedinstvenih stavki s tog popisa.
➤ Prije svega, moramo upisati sljedeću formulu u ćeliju D3 .
=IFERROR(INDEX($B$3:$B$10, MATCH(0, FREQUENCY(IF(EXACT($B$3:$B$10,TRANSPOSE($D$2:D2)), MATCH(ROW($B$3:$B$10), ROW($B$3:$B$10)), ""), MATCH(ROW($B$3:$B$10), ROW($B$3:$B$10))), 0)), "")
➤ Nakon toga ćemo pritisnuti Enter .
➤ Mi ćemo povući formulu pomoću Ručka za popunjavanje .
➤ Konačno, možemo vidjeti izdvojene jedinstvene vrijednosti osjetljive na velika i mala slova u tablici Velika i mala slova Osjetljive različite vrijednosti .
Metoda-7: Zaokretna tablica za izdvajanje jedinstvenih stavki s popisa
Jedinstvene stavke možemo izdvojiti iz sljedećeg Popis proizvoda upotrebom Zaokretne tablice .
➤ Prije svega, miće odabrati raspon skupa podataka iz kojeg želimo izdvojiti jedinstvene stavke.
➤ Ovdje odabiremo raspon podataka C4 do C12 .
➤ Nakon toga, odaberite karticu Insert iz Ribbon .
➤ Zatim odaberite Pivot Table .
➤ Nakon toga, moramo odabrati Postojeći radni list .
➤ Moramo dati lokaciju. Ovdje odabiremo lokaciju E4 do E12 .
➤ Označi Dodaj ove podatke u podatkovni model
➤ Kliknite OK .
➤ Konačno, to možemo vidjeti kada označimo Naziv proizvoda u zaokretnoj tablici , ekstrahirani jedinstveni proizvod pojavljuje se u tablici Razine retka .
Metoda-8: VBA za izdvajanje jedinstvenog
iz sljedeću tablicu Popis proizvoda , želimo izdvojiti jedinstveni Naziv proizvoda pomoću VBA koda.
➤ Prije svega, ukucat ćemo ALT+F11 u naš radni list. Ovdje radimo na Sheet8 .
➤ Nakon toga će se pojaviti prozor VBA projekta.
➤ Moramo dvaput kliknuti na Sheet8 .
➤ Pojavit će se VBA prozor uređivača.
➤ Upisat ćemo sljedeći kod u prozor uređivača VBA .
2386
Ovdje smo deklarirali Long unesite varijablu i umetnuli zadnji red unutar nje. Zatim primijenite nekoliko metoda ActiveSheet za kopiranje raspona zadržavajući Unique kao True .
➤ Mi ćemozatvorite VBA prozor uređivača i otići ćemo na naš aktivni Sheet8.
➤ Tamo ćemo upisati ALT+F8 i pojavit će se prozor naziva makronaredbe.
➤ Kliknut ćemo na Pokreni .
➤ Konačno, vidjet ćemo jedinstvene proizvode u Naziv proizvoda tablica.
Pročitajte više: Excel VBA za dobivanje jedinstvenih vrijednosti iz stupca (4 primjera)
Metoda-9: Istaknite jedinstvene stavke
Želimo istaknuti jedinstveni Naziv proizvoda sa sljedećeg Popisa proizvoda .
➤ Prvo, mi odaberite Naziv proizvoda od C5 do C12 .
➤ Zatim ćemo ići na Kartica Početna .
➤ Odaberite Uvjetno oblikovanje .
➤ Zatim odaberite Novo pravilo .
Pojavit će se prozor Novo pravilo oblikovanja .
➤ Odaberite Upotrijebi formulu da odredite koje ćelije formatirati .
➤ Napišite sljedeću formulu u okvir Formatiraj vrijednosti gdje je ova formula točna .
=COUNTIF($C$5:C5,C5)=1
➤ Zatim kliknite na Format .
A Pojavit će se prozor Format Cells .
➤ Kliknite na opciju Fill .
➤ Odaberite boju, ovdje odabiremo plavu.
➤ Zatim kliknite OK .
➤ Sada pogledajte Pregled i kliknite OK .
➤ Konačno, možemo vidjeti istaknuti jedinstveni Naziv proizvoda .
Metoda-10: Uvjetno oblikovanje za dohvaćanje jedinstvenih stavki
U sljedećem Popis proizvoda u tablici, želimo sakriti duplikat Naziv proizvoda i želimo prikazati samo jedinstvene nazive proizvoda.
➤ Da bismo to učinili, prvo moramo odabrati Naziv proizvoda od ćelija C5 do C12 .
➤ Nakon toga, otići ćemo na karticu Početna na Vrpci i moramo odabrati Uvjetno oblikovanje .
➤ Zatim odaberite Novo pravilo .
Pojavit će se prozor Novo pravilo oblikovanja .
➤ Moramo odabrati Upotrijebi formulu za određivanje ćelija za formatiranje .
➤ Zapisujemo sljedeću formulu u okvir Formatiraj vrijednosti gdje je ova formula istinita .
=COUNTIF($C$5:C5,C5)>1
➤ Zatim, kliknite na Format .
Pojavit će se prozor Format Cells .
➤ Odabrat ćemo Opcija fontova.
➤ Zatim moramo odabrati bijelu Boju teme.
➤ Kliknite na U redu .
➤ Možemo vidjeti Pregled i kliknuti U redu .
➤ Sada možemo vidjeti da se dobivaju dupli nazivi proizvoda skriveni jer su bijeli.
➤ Sada želimo razvrstati jedinstvene proizvode na vrhu popisa. Stoga moramo desnom tipkom miša kliknuti bilo koju ćeliju. Ovdje desnom tipkom miša kliknemo ćeliju C5 .
➤ Nakon toga moramo odabrati opciju Filtar .
➤ Sada moramo odabrati Filtriranje po boji fonta odabranih ćelija .
➤ Konačno, možemo vidjeti da postojisamo jedinstveni naziv proizvoda na tablici Popis proizvoda .